Educational Background
Students may enter the program with a bachelor's degree only or with a master’s degree.
Students with a Bachelor’s Degree
Students entering the program with a bachelor’s degree, without a master’s degree, will be required to write a master’s thesis as they matriculate through the PhD program. They will have an option to earn an MA in Sociology, or just to complete the master’s thesis and proceed to complete the PhD program without earning the MA degree.
Students with a Master's Degree
Students entering the program with a master's degree (e.g., MA, MPH, MPA) are granted waivers for a maximum of 15 semester hours of substantive graduate work. Students who have completed a master’s thesis will submit their master’s thesis for review by the PhD program. If the thesis is deemed acceptable, the master’s thesis requirement on the way to PhD is waived. Students with a master’s degree who have not written a master's thesis for their prior degree will be required to write one as they matriculate through the PhD program. Earning MA in Sociology from UAB on the way to PhD in Medical Sociology is optional.
Graduate Transfer Students without a Graduate Degree
Students transferring from another graduate program without a graduate degree may be granted waivers for a maximum of 12 semester hours of substantive graduate work. Waivers are approved by the PhD program director and the professors in charge of the respective coursework in question. The transfer credit allowance is governed by the UAB Graduate School and may change (check the current Graduate Catalog).

Minimum Admission Requirements
- A bachelor's or master's degree from an accredited institution in sociology or a related field with a minimum of 18 hours of social science coursework, preferably including social theory, statistics, and research methodology.
- An overall grade point average (GPA) of 3.0 based on a 4.0 system, or a 3.2 GPA for the last 60 semester hours in a BA/BS program.
- A 3.0 GPA in all previous graduate coursework.
- For international students, a minimum T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) score of 80 and an acceptable score on the Test of Written English (TWE) or a minimum score of 6.5 on the IELTS.
Exceptional students who fail to meet any of the above requirements will be evaluated on a case‑by‑case basis. The following criteria are also considered in the admissions process:
- Evidence of scholarship
- Statement of career goals, with emphasis on research and scholarship
- Evidence of quantitative preparation/ability
- Letters of recommendation
- Professional experience
